Tim, thanks. That is what I'm doing. I have some extra 24v lithium ion power tool batteries that i don't use. I currently power my 12v cargo trailer lights with a deep cycle marine battery. I bought a 24v to 12v step down converter and plan to power them with a 4 amp hour 24 volt battery. ( I can eliminate the 80lb deep cycle) Each of the three lights only draw .25 amps, so my question is will I have 5.33 hours of run time, or will it increase since I'm lowering the voltage?
